FUTURE COMPUTING 2021 , The Twelfth International Conference on Future Computational Paradigms and Applications, targets advanced computational paradigms and their applications. The target is to cover (i) the advanced research on computational techniques that apply the newest human-like decisions, and (ii) applications on various domains. The new development led to special computational facets on mechanism-oriented computing, large-scale computing and technology-oriented computing. They are largely expected to play an important role in cloud systems, on-demand services, autonomic systems, and pervasive applications and services.
